Schalke are yet to sign anyone and yet to sell anyone for any money too. They've lost Nubel, Caliguiri, Kenny, Gregoritsch and Todibo among others off the wage bill, but if they need cash they need to sell at least one or two assets.

 

They've self-imposed a salary cap of €2.5m a season so any player won't earn more than £45k there.

 

The only other player I've seen linked for sale from them is Weston McKennie, whose deal to Hertha fell through but could still move to England. If they need quick cash this one could move quickly if we have genuine interest.
